What skills and experience we're looking for

We are looking for child focused staff that enjoy playing and supporting children to explore and develop their understanding of the world around them.

The successful candidate will be able to:

  • Inspire and motivate children
  • Communicate with families
  • Work as part of a committed, friendly and hardworking team

What the school offers its staff

The school and Nursery can offer you:

  • A forward thinking, dynamic atmosphere where lifelong learning has high priority
  • A happy environment with real team work
  • New and innovative ways of working including online observations and communications with parents through Class Dojo and parent hub
  • Every opportunity to develop your skills
  • An innovative EYFS curriculum where creativity and personalised learning are core elements

We offer:

  • Local Government Pension Scheme membership
  • A staff benefit scheme providing discounts on everything from food shopping to insurances and holidays, as well as 24/7 access to health care professionals and online wellbeing advice.
  • Our values driven approach and the opportunity to work in a supportive, collaborative and friendly environment.

Commitment to safeguarding

LIHT is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children, young people and vulnerable adults and expects all staff and volunteers to share this commitment. We follow safer recruitment practice and the successful applicant will need a satisfactory enhanced DBS certificate and supportive references.

We foster a culture of inclusivity that celebrates differences, promotes understanding, and ensures that no one is discriminated against in any way. By embracing diversity, we believe we can tap into the unique perspectives and talents of our employees, creating a more innovative and creative workforce that can better meet the needs of our pupils.
